Pale Blue Dot: A Vision of the Human Future in Space by Carl Sagan is a profound exploration of our place in the universe, inspired by the famous photograph taken by Voyager 1. This first paperback edition features stunning full-color illustrations and photographs from NASA missions, blending scientific insight with philosophical reflection on planetary exploration and the future of humanity among the stars. It includes a comprehensive index and bibliographical references, making it an essential addition to any science lover's library.
